What if we stopped speculating about ALSPs and instead started collecting data to gather useful information? That’s exactly what this episode is about. 


Host Mike Madison talks with Lucy Ricca and David Freeman Engstrom from Stanford Law School's Deborah L. Rhode Center on the Legal Profession about their research into the results so far of Utan's "regulatory sandbox" innovation, which created space for non-traditional providers of legal services.


Their report, titled "Legal Innovation After Reform: Evidence from Regulatory Change," is available here.
